Output 64ecec79da0232381de33d4a3eda4b8ad88319ab11da720f178863ecb1d3f4e3:3

value
45336629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94cfd38572b57e5472a9773890835c75ab197503 OP_EQUAL
address
MMU1CqpDXHVMcscbdQkbmuE3Agu47CWEqu
transaction
64ecec79da0232381de33d4a3eda4b8ad88319ab11da720f178863ecb1d3f4e3
spent
true